## The job to be done

Deploying large-scale electric vehicle charging infrastructure requires more than just engineering and capital. It demands local community acceptance, municipal alignment, and political goodwill. For a public affairs manager at a clean energy provider, the primary challenge is identifying which benefit-framing angles will resonate most with diverse local stakeholders. Whether launching a high-power charging hub in a suburban neighborhood or expanding a municipal network, different cohorts react to different narratives. Some residents care about local air quality, others worry about grid stability, while local business owners focus on economic foot traffic. If the public affairs manager chooses the wrong framing, they risk triggering local resistance, NIMBYism, and prolonged permitting delays that can stall projects for months. The stakes are incredibly high: delayed rollouts mean missed revenue, lost market share, and damaged relationships with municipal partners. The public affairs manager must deliver a validated communication strategy to the executive board and regional project developers, proving that the proposed messaging will minimize friction and accelerate local approvals. This requires a deep understanding of regional anxieties, local economic priorities, and environmental attitudes across multiple demographic segments.

## What today's workflow looks like (and where it breaks)

To find the right messaging, public affairs managers traditionally rely on a mix of external research agencies, local focus groups, community surveys, and public polling. This workflow is slow, expensive, and fraught with political risk. Commissioning a traditional panel or focus group takes weeks, if not months, to recruit, execute, and analyze. By the time the agency briefs are returned, the project timeline has often moved forward, making the insights outdated. Furthermore, conducting physical surveys or public polling in a sensitive municipality can backfire. Simply asking questions about upcoming infrastructure projects can alert opposition groups, spark premature local controversy, and create negative press before the clean energy provider even has a chance to explain the project benefits. Traditional panels also suffer from severe sample bias, as the loudest voices often dominate focus groups, while moderate residents remain silent. The high per-respondent recruitment costs make it financially impossible to test multiple messaging variations across dozens of different municipal demographics, leaving the public affairs manager to rely on gut feeling or generic, unoptimized templates that fail to address local concerns.
